V. Craig Jordan is a scholar working on Genetics, Cancer Research and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, V. Craig Jordan has authored 9 papers receiving a total of 500 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Genetics, 4 papers in Cancer Research and 3 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in V. Craig Jordan’s work include Estrogen and related hormone effects (8 papers), Breast Cancer Treatment Studies (3 papers) and DNA and Nucleic Acid Chemistry (2 papers). V. Craig Jordan is often cited by papers focused on Estrogen and related hormone effects (8 papers), Breast Cancer Treatment Studies (3 papers) and DNA and Nucleic Acid Chemistry (2 papers). V. Craig Jordan collaborates with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Japan. V. Craig Jordan's co-authors include Julia Lindgren, Douglass C. Tormey, Malcolm M. Bilimoria, Danny Wolf, John J. Pink, Yasuo Hozumi, Miyuki Kawano‐Kawada, Ivy Weiss, Shunsuke Sakurai and Anait S. Levenson and has published in prestigious journals such as Nucleic Acids Research, British Journal of Cancer and Journal of Cellular Biochemistry.
